After 4-year hiatus, ECI announces polls for J&K Rajya Sabha berths | KNO

Voting and counting for 4 seats on October 24; 3 elections to be held for 4 Seats

Srinagar, Sep 24 (KNO): The Election Commission of India (ECI) on Wednesday announced the schedule for elections to four Rajya Sabha seats from the Union Territory of Jammu & Kashmir. According to a notification issued by the poll -body, a copy of which is in possession of news agency—Kashmir News Observer (KNO), the Commission will issue the notification for these seats on October 6. As per the schedule, the last date for filing nominations is October 13, while scrutiny of nominations will take place on October 14. The last date for withdrawal of candidatures is October 16. Voting will be held on October 24 between 9:00 AM and 4:00 PM, the notification states. Counting of votes will take place on the same day at 5:00 PM. The four Rajya Sabha seats-previously held by Mir Muhammad Fayaz, Shamsher Singh, Ghulam Nabi Azad, and Nazir Ahmed Laway-have remained vacant since their retirement in February 2021. The poll body attributed the delay in holding elections to the non-availability of the required electorate at the time the vacancies occurred. Elected MLAs constitute the electorate for these elections. Nominated MLAs are not eligible to participate in Rajya Sabha polls. The Commission stated that these seats will be filled through three separate elections-one each for two seats and a combined election for the two seats that became vacant simultaneously. As per the notification, the tenure of the newly elected members will be subject to the outcome of a pending Supreme Court case-SLP (C) No. 17123/2015 (Election Commission of India vs. Devesh Chandra Thakur & Others)—(KNO)
